I connected all the Matrixes together by a flatcable between the ICSP programming connectors removing the MISO and CS wires. Next I build a simple board with a PCF8574A (An I2C 8-bit I/O Expander) that provides the Chip Select signals for the RGB Matrix boards. (I’ll post a schematic when the project matures).
Next thing to do is update the software in the RGB matrixes. These matrixes all have an Atmel atmega8 controller. I hope I can make the displays PWM compatible so I can make more colors..
